The MLW RS-11 is a classic diesel locomotive model produced by the Montreal Locomotive Works (MLW) in Canada. It is well-regarded for its reliability and versatility, serving in freight and passenger rail services across North America for many years.
This locomotive is equipped with a powerful diesel engine that provides the necessary traction for hauling heavy loads. Its robust design and construction make it suitable for various rail applications, from long-haul freight trains to shorter commuter routes.
The MLW RS-11 is known for its distinctive appearance, featuring a rugged and functional exterior. It has been a workhorse in the railway industry, earning a reputation for dependable performance in diverse operating conditions.

Did you know?
The MLW RS-11 was part of the RS series of locomotives produced by Montreal Locomotive Works, which included several variants with different specifications.
Although newer locomotives with advanced technology have since replaced many RS-11 units, its legacy as a dependable workhorse in the rail industry endures.
